#1332fc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1332fc is composed of 7.5% red, 19.6%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.5%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 232 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 53.1%. #1332fc color hex could be obtained by blending #2664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#1332fc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1332fc has RGB values of R:19, G:50,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1258236.

Shades and Tints of #1332fc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000210 is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1332fc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81838e is the less saturated color, while #1332fc is the most saturated one.
